Frequently asked questions

Is the 2007 Dodge Charger reliable?

NHTSA has 678 consumer complaints on record for the 2007 Dodge Charger and 2 recalls. The most-reported problem area is power train (152 reports). These are unverified consumer reports filed with the government, not validated failure rates, and are not adjusted for how many 2007 Dodge Charger units were produced — popular vehicles naturally accumulate more reports.

What are the most common problems with the 2007 Dodge Charger?

Owners most often report problems with: power train (152), engine (82), air bags (77), power train:automatic transmission (48). Each figure is the number of complaints filed with NHTSA for this exact model year.
